The adaptive suboptimal dual control strategy that there exist the unknown parameters in the stochastic system with time delay is studied in this paper. The forgetting factor recursive least square (FFRLS) is selected to estimate the unknown parameters; According to the certainty equivalence principle and the generalized predictive control strategy, the non-dual controller is obtained. In term of the bicriterial approach, the dual controller which processes both the controlling and the learning effect is derived. The simulating example illustrates that the proposed method can not only apply with the non-minimum phase system but also improve the robustness.
